For the pilot of Hazbin, there was some variety in the swears and how much each chatacter used them. I probably would have to read the transcript to figure out exactly what each character said but I think have a pretty good round view to give a decent analysis:

Charlie - Most of her swearing is done in the song "Inside of Every Demon is a Rainbow" to describe the different people in Hell; there's only three other instances when she swears I believe when she calls Katie Killjoy a bitch (which to me felt like it was intentionally forced from Charlie), quoting her dad, and calling Alastor "sketchy-as-fuck"; she doesn't express much negativity, and when she does she uses not as harsh words such as "uncool"

Vaggie - Swears when she's angry and yelling, i.e. the scene in the limousine; is able to control her tongue unless she blows a fuse

Angel Dust - Swears quite a bit; most of it is sexual in nature due to kind of person and job he is in

Cherri Bomb - Probably the third to swear the most in ratio to her screentime; is a pyromaniac punk so it fits in her nature to be crude

Sir Pentious - Don't think he swore at all; most of his insults might be considered old-fashioned as he seems to be behind in the times

Alastor - Though a sociopathic serial killer, using foul language would consider to be beneath him; has to remain classy to the public

Husk - Most likely to be the one to swear constantly and drop the most f-bombs; a cynical drunken old man that doesn't care how others perceive him

Niffty - Is obviously unhinged but is polite; probably a reference to a 50s housewife's squeaky-clean facade

Katie Killjoy - Swears but also knows how to look professional while doing so; will treat you like shit with the biggest smile on her face

TLDR: Not every character swears and the ones who do have a variety and intensity to the words they use depending on their character
 
So I actually looked at the transcript from the pilot and put down every vulgar/offensive word that came from the dialogue. A number is added to the end of a word if it's uswd more than once from said character. Mind you this is just the words themselves so an offensive statement like "don't put your taco in a twist" is not included since none of the words themselves would be considered crude on there own. This also includes references/innuendos to sex if not deliberate; ie. the word "porn" is included in the list but not "harder daddy". I also put down whenever someone said "God" because some people do find offense using the Lord's name in vain. And I also referenced when Hell was used as the location. Hopefully, this makes the criteria that I used here understandable:
Charlie: Hell (location)×4; Shit×2; Bitch; Fuck
Charlie (Singing): Hell (location)×2; Fuck-ups; Sluts; Sexual; Porn

Alastor: Hell (Location)
Alastor (Singing): Hell

Vaggie: Fucking; Mierda (Shit); Malparido (Bastard); Bullshit; Cabron (Bastard); Perra (Bitch); Shitlord; Hell (Location)×2; Brothel

Angel Dust: Shit; Damn; God; Bitches; Shitload; Kinky; Sex; Tits; Hell (Location); Bitch; Jack-offs; Fucking; Pimp; Dick

Husk: Fuck×2; Bitch; Damn; Hell; Shitting; Fucking×3

Sir Pentious: Hell (location); Fetuses; Whores; God; Damn; Pervert

Cherri Bomb: Bullshit; Shit×2

Katie Killjoy: Hell (location)x3; Limp-dick; Jackass; Dick; Shit×2; Fuck; Fucking×2; Shits; Hooker; Porn

Tom Trench: Porn

Misc: Slut; Bitch; Shit

So while I was a bit off, I think I got the general idea of each character correct. I'm also a bit shock that the word "fuck" wasn't used as much as I originally thought. There's only 12 times it's used in the pilot; which compared to how an average episode of Hazbin usually goes, it's not a lot.
